How Love Works

It’s funny how love works sometimes
one minute
you’re both strangers
the next
you’re in love
with a man
whom you can never have
he proposes
to every girl
any girl
besides you
even though
he never paid to take up space
in your brain
or your heart
and he leads you on
until
he doesn’t.
and you’re wishing you’d done something
said something
but you did do something
you loved him
